What does flumazenil mean?
Flumazenil means (pharmacology) A benzodiazepine antagonist used to counter drowsiness caused by benzodiazepines..

/fluˈmæz.əˌnɪl/ · noun
(pharmacology) A benzodiazepine antagonist used to counter drowsiness caused by benzodiazepines..
The documents indicate that Dr. Murray tried to revive Mr. Jackson with flumazenil, which reverses the effects of benzodiazepines like lorazepam.
